Output 1cc656c2a4af90d6f46c13c4b908fac84ed0b2507dc62ae2dc01774a1c239a56:0

value
8157830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d58376b6c427177700812653fe0193a8618ec1 OP_EQUAL
address
MTDEb5yStCwbpz5yHHyTvvZdotiJjBLVnk
transaction
1cc656c2a4af90d6f46c13c4b908fac84ed0b2507dc62ae2dc01774a1c239a56
spent
true